Brazil Sets Strategic Course for eSports Olympics 2027 in Riyadh
eSports to Join Olympic Movement in 2027 The global sporting landscape is evolving, and in 2027, a major milestone will mark this transformation—the inaugural edition of the eSports Olympics, scheduled to be held in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ia. In anticipation of this groundbreaking event, the Brazilian Olympic Committee (COB) has begun laying the groundwork for the nation’s participation, signaling a strategic pivot toward the digital future of competitive sports. COB Puts eSports on the National Agenda With just over 100 days under the current leadership, the COB has prioritized eSports as a crucial frontier. The committee has initiated study groups to understand the digital sports ecosystem and prepare the national framework for participation.
